-### BEGIN INIT INFO
-# Provides: openvswitch-monitor
-# Required-Start: $network $local_fs $remote_fs
-# Required-Stop: $remote_fs
-# Should-Start: $named $syslog openvswitch-switch
-# Should-Stop:
-# Default-Start: 2 3 4 5
-# Default-Stop: 0 1 6
-# Short-Description: Open vSwitch switch monitor
-### END INIT INFO
-
-PATH=/usr/local/sbin:/usr/local/bin:/sbin:/bin:/usr/sbin:/usr/bin
-
-DAEMON=/usr/sbin/ovs-monitor
-NAME=ovs-monitor
-DESC="Open vSwitch switch monitor"
-
-PIDFILE=/var/run/openvswitch/$NAME.pid
-
-test -x $DAEMON || exit 0
-
-. /lib/lsb/init-functions
-
-# Default options, these can be overriden by the information
-# at /etc/default/openvswitch-monitor
-DAEMON_OPTS="" # Additional options given to the daemon
-
-DODTIME=10 # Time to wait for the daemon to die, in seconds
- # If this value is set too low you might not
- # let some daemons to die gracefully and
- # 'restart' will not work
-
-# Include defaults if available
-default=/etc/default/openvswitch-monitor
-if [ -f $default ] ; then
- . $default
-fi
-
-set -e
-
-running_pid() {
-# Check if a given process pid's cmdline matches a given name
- pid=$1
- name=$2
- [ -z "$pid" ] && return 1
- [ ! -d /proc/$pid ] && return 1
- return 0
-}
-
-running() {
-# Check if the process is running looking at /proc
-# (works for all users)
-
- # No pidfile, probably no daemon present
- [ ! -f "$PIDFILE" ] && return 1
- pid=`cat $PIDFILE`
- running_pid $pid $DAEMON || return 1
- return 0
-}
-
-start_daemon() {
-# Start the process using the wrapper
- if test $THRESHOLD != 0; then
- start-stop-daemon --start --quiet -m --background --pidfile $PIDFILE \
- --exec $DAEMON -- -c $THRESHOLD -i $INTERVAL -l $LOG_FILE \
- -s $SWITCH_VCONN $DAEMON_OPTS
- fi
-
- # Wait up to 3 seconds for the daemon to start.
- for i in 1 2 3; do
- if running; then
- break
- fi
- sleep 1
- done
-}
-
-stop_daemon() {
- start-stop-daemon -o --stop --pidfile $PIDFILE
- rm $PIDFILE
-}
-
-case "$1" in
- start)
- log_daemon_msg "Starting $DESC " "$NAME"
- # Check if it's running first
- if running ; then
- log_progress_msg "apparently already running"
- log_end_msg 0
- exit 0
- fi
- if start_daemon && running ; then
- # It's ok, the daemon started and is running
- log_end_msg 0
- else
- # Either we could not start it or it is not running
- # after we did
- # NOTE: Some daemons might die some time after they start,
- # this code does not try to detect this and might give
- # a false positive (use 'status' for that)
- log_end_msg 1
- fi
- ;;
- stop)
- log_daemon_msg "Stopping $DESC" "$NAME"
- if running ; then
- # Only stop the daemon if we see it running
- stop_daemon
- log_end_msg $?
- else
- # If it's not running don't do anything
- log_progress_msg "apparently not running"
- log_end_msg 0
- exit 0
- fi
- ;;
- restart|force-reload)
- log_daemon_msg "Restarting $DESC" "$NAME"
- if running ; then
- stop_daemon
- # Wait some sensible amount, some daemons need this
- [ -n "$DIETIME" ] && sleep $DIETIME
- fi
- start_daemon
- running
- log_end_msg $?
- ;;
- status)
- log_daemon_msg "Checking status of $DESC" "$NAME"
- if running ; then
- log_progress_msg "running"
- log_end_msg 0
- else
- log_progress_msg "apparently not running"
- log_end_msg 1
- exit 1
- fi
- ;;
- # Use this if the daemon cannot reload
- reload)
- log_warning_msg "Reloading $NAME daemon: not implemented, as the daemon"
- log_warning_msg "cannot re-read the config file (use restart)."
- ;;
- *)
- N=/etc/init.d/openvswitch-monitor
- echo "Usage: $N {start|stop|restart|force-reload|status}" >&2
- exit 1
- ;;
-esac
